The Salento Cinema Film Society, the Italian Cultural Institute and the Consulate General of Italy in Hong Kong, in collaboration with the Hong Kong Economic and Trade Office (HKETO), are pleased to present the 8th annual edition of the Hong Kong Salento International Film Festival to be held in Hong Kong from May 28 through May 30, 2019 at the Hong Kong Arts Centre, in Wan Chai, a multi-arts centre that fosters artistic exchanges locally and internationally, bringing the most forward creations to Hong Kong and showcasing homegrown talents abroad.

The eighth annual edition of the Hong Kong Salento International Film Festival is part of “Fare Cinema”, a project wanted by the Italian Ministry of Foreign Affairs with the support of the diplomatic Consular Network and the Italian Cultural Institutes to promote abroad quality Italian film productions. HKSIFF highlights world-class independent films with an Italian and international focus.

HKSIFF Opens in May for its 8th Edition

From Sunday May 28 through Thursday May 30, the celebration of international independent cinema from all over the world continues in Hong Kong. Since 2004, SIFF has been screening the world’s best indie films to large international audiences: a unique opportunity to watch the real independent cinema. Many of the festival’s “Official Selection” films become part of SIFF WORLD, which takes the films on tour every year through about 14 cities such as Hong Kong, Yerevan, Moscow, St. Petersburg, Santiago de Chile, London, Oslo and many more. The Hong Kong Salento International Film Festival will bring to Hong Kong a selection of the Best of the Fest 2018 Edition, to be screened at the Hong Kong Arts Centre – Louis Koo Cinema, one of the six best arthouse cinemas in Hong Kong. DETAILS AND SYNOPSIS:

 

AGADAH by Alberto Rondalli | Italy 2018 | 126’ | H.K. Premiere

Language: Italian, Spanish with English Subtitles

Category III: Persons Aged 18 and Above Only / No one younger than 18 years of age are permitted to rent, purchase, or watch this film in a movie theatre

May 1734, Alfonso of van Worden, a young officer of the Walloon at the service of King Charles, received the order to reach his regiment in Naples in the shortest possible time. Lopez, his faithful servant, having tried to dissuade him from crossing the plateau of the Murgie, because the place is infested with ghosts and disquieting demons, sets off on a journey with him. In a fantastic plot, between dream and reality, which recalls the Decamerone and the Thousand and One Nights, Alfonso will live an initiatory journey, during ten long days, between hallucinations and magic in mysterious caves, infamous inns, scabrous loves and diabolical apparitions.

 

ISOLATION by Morteza-Ali Abbas-Mirzaei | Iran 2017 | 93’ | H.K. Premiere

Language: Persian with English Subtitles

Category IIA: Not suitable for children

Zohreh is stalked on the way home. She finds this out in the middle of the way and runs away. This leads to her death in a car accident. Her husband, Parviz, has the head jailer’s green light to go on bail for 72 hours to bury and say farewell to Zohreh. However he has other concerns…

 

COWBOY’S HEART by Guy Pereira | Brazil 2018 | 120’ | H.K. Premiere

Language: Portuguese with English Subtitles

Category IIA: Not suitable for children

Lucca is a struggling country singer who is forced by his manager Iolanda to record cheesy pop-country songs. Upon a disagreement during a studio recording session, Lucca returns to his hometown in order to find inspiration for his music.

 

IMPERFECT AGE by Ulisse Lendaro | Italy 2017 | 96’ | H.K. Premiere

Language: Italian, Spanish with English Subtitles

Category IIB: Not suitable for young persons and children

A film that goes straight to the heart of emotions. The imperfect age, adolescence, with all its excesses and, indeed, its innumerable imperfections. Camilla is a seventeen-year-old girl with the dream of becoming a dancer, despite her mother’s concerns. One day, at dance lesson, she meets Sara, an aspiring dancer like her, and her life will never be the same.

 

DOMINO EFFECT by Fabio Massa | Italy 2017 | 80’ | H.K. Premiere

Language: Italian with English Subtitles

Category IIB: Not suitable for young persons and children

The film tells the story of Lorenzo, a thirty year old that finally realizes his dream of going to Africa to teach. Right in the best moment of his experience, bad news about his health unleash a domino effect on his life and those of people close to him!

 

KAYLA by Kate Bohan | China/USA 2018 | 122’ | H.K. Premiere

Language: English, Mandarin with English & Mandarin Subtitles

Category I: For exhibition to persons of any age

Seven-year-old Kayla’s father dies unexpectedly on a mission in the U.S which changes Kayla’s life completely. She takes on the responsibility of her broken family. She inspires the people around her with love and singing. And in the end, she manages to carve out a happy life.
